2EQB

Crystal structure of the Rab GTPase Sec4p, the Sec2p GEF domain, and phosphate complex

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sSPRING-8 BEAMLINE BL41XU
Synchrotron siteSPring-8
BeamlineBL41XU
Temperature [K]100
Detector technologyCCD
Collection date2006-12-12
DetectorADSC QUANTUM 315
Wavelength(s)1.0000
Spacegroup nameI 2 2 2
Unit cell lengths116.581, 117.422, 123.332
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ution48.080 - 2.700
R-factor0.273
Rwork0.273
R-free0.29800
Structure solution methodMAD
RMSD bond length0.008
RMSD bond angle1.500
Data reduction softwareDENZO
Data scaling softwareSCALEPACK
Phasing softwareSHARP
Refinement softwareCNS (1.1)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]50.0002.750
High resolution limit [Å]2.7002.700
Number of reflections23619
<I/σ(I)>12.72.07
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P7.2293150mM Dipotassium hydrogenphosphate, 17% PEG 3350, 150mM dimethyl(2-hydroxyethyl)ammonium propane sulfonate, pH 7.2, VAPOR DIFFUSION, SITTING DROP, temperature 293K
